For those who haven't heard, cinemas worldwide will be showing a 15 minute preview of James Cameron's Avatar on August 21st.

Apparently, only the BFI London and Manchester IMAX will be showing the IMAX print as there are only two copies allocated to the UK. Details are sketchy about the Real-D and regular versions, but I expect most capable cinemas will have some showings at least.

I will be seeing the final film in IMAX so probably won't bother with the trek to Manchester for this. I hope Real-D is enough to sufficiently melt my eyeballs.

My mate who works for Peter Jackson's WETA was over from New Zealand on Tuesday and I met up for lunch with him.
They've been working on Avatar for a long time now (over 2 years I think) and they're deadline is November.
He got to meet James Cameron recently and said what a nice bloke he was (albeit quite imposing). He's also managed to see a good cut of the film. He said it was 3h15m long, but that it was simply brilliant - so I can't wait either.
